Pizza Hut has a futuristic new round pizza box that looks like a spaceship.
Partnering with food startup Zume, Pizza Hut is testing the new round box at a Phoenix location for one day only on Wednesday, the chain announced Tuesday.
The pizza box will be available as part of a one-day event at the Pizza Hut at 3602 E. Thomas Road, at which Pizza Hut will also be testing a pizza with a plant-based "meat" topping called "Incogmeato." Incogmeato is an all-new plant-based "meat" from Kellogg-owned Morningstar Farms and will be served on a Garden Specialty Pizza.
